Vision Contracting

dublin ireland, Ireland
Part time
3 hours ago
cork ireland, Ireland
Part time
3 hours ago
dublin ireland, Ireland
Part time
3 hours ago
cork ireland, Ireland
Part time
3 hours ago
dublin ireland, Ireland
Part time
3 hours ago